WebHavoc definition, great destruction or devastation; ruinous damage. See more. WebTo wreck is to ruin something, to wreak is to cause something to happen, and to reek is to smell bad. A wreck is something that has been destroyed, like a car wreck or a ship wreck …
Webpollution. fog. unwholesomeness. exhalation. foul air. air pollution. “At first she thought it was thunder, but she soon noticed white gas appearing in her room accompanied by a … WebMar 27, 2008 · reek [reek] n. a bad smell reek [reek] v. to emit a bad smell The Old English word rec meant “smoke from burning material.” Reek acquired the sense of “stench” in the 17th century.
